Description:
We created a worksheet for your youngest students. It is going to be very easy and fun for kids to learn figures with such a paper. There are different fruits such as bananas, kiwi, pineapples, and some other ones. All of them have a bright color and look delicious. It is much more interesting for children to learn counting with fruits. Just try it and you will be impressed by the results. We do our best to find the best ways of teaching.
